How to Do the Steam Vent Game on Steamworks Island
- 1). Click quickly on the metal tiles that cover the board as soon as the mini-game starts. This will uncover the vents and allow you to see what you are working with. The first board has a four-by-four grid and you must connect the entry pipe on the left side of the screen to the exit on the right side.
- 2). Click on a vent tile to pick it up and then click on the location where you want to place it. Once a vent turns red it means it is filled with steam and you can no longer move it.
- 3). Click the lever marked "Finish" situated on the right side of the screen once you have connected the entry and exit points and you will advance to the next board.
- 4). Click on the metal tiles that cover the board to uncover them, but do not try to expose all of them. Instead, focus on a path from the left to the right as this time the board size is six-by-six, giving you more tiles to work with. Only click on more metal tiles if the ones you have already uncovered do not have type of vents you need to connect the entry and exit points.
- 5). Click the "Finish" lever once the entry and exit points are connected before the steam manages to escape. You will be taken to the third and final board of the mini-game which is on an eight-by-eight grid.
- 6). Click on the metal tiles starting from the left side to uncover the vents underneath. Line up the vents so that the steam can travel through them to the exit point on the bottom right side of the board. You have more vents to work with but this also means you have to connect more together and at this point the steam is flowing very quickly, so you have to be quick with your clicking.
- 7). Click the "Finish" lever once you have the entry and exit points connected and the mini-game will be completed. You will now be able to continue with the rest of the island.
